
We are officially one year past the final Monitoring and Maintenance Reports for our HCA Mitigation Area projects at Brick Creek and Cedar Creek in Gresham, OR. The mitigation work was conducted to compensate for HCA impacts associated with construction in a nearby subdivision. PCD’s Landscape Architecture team worked closely with a local Natural Resources firm to create a planting and implementation plan and worked with the developer to complete annual monitoring visits. We also provided recommendations to ensure the success of the planting area during the reporting period. We had fun mucking around in the field for each data collection visit, after which we generated status reports.
The final site visit included making final observations and comparing site conditions from the last report. Photos and notes were taken in the field and compiled in to the final report. Overall survival rate of planted plants from 2023-2024 was 98%, and the resulting recommendation was to plant only 9 additional plants.
